HC Deb 18 May 1893 vol 12 c1244
SIR FREDERICK SEAGER HUNT (Marylebone, W.)

I beg to ask the Secretary of State for War whether, with reference to his statement to the effect that the Government have thought it desirable to make some addition to the pay of Colonels on half-pay during their period of suspended animation, he is now in a position to inform the house what addition it has been decided to make; and whether the additional payment will take effect from the commencement of the present financial year or from a prior date?

*MR. CAMPBELL-BANNERMAN

I am sorry for the delay which has occurred in this matter; but if the hon. Gentleman will repeat the question after the Recess, I shall be able to give him a positive answer.
